Learning Implicit Generative Models by Teaching Density Estimators

被引:1
|
作者
Xu, Kun [1 ]
Du, Chao [1 ]
Li, Chongxuan [1 ]
Zhu, Jun [1 ]
Zhang, Bo [1 ]
机构
[1] Tsinghua Univ, Dept Comp Sci & Technol, Tsinghua Bosch ML Ctr, BNRist Ctr,Inst AI,THBI Lab, Beijing, Peoples R China
关键词
Deep generative models; Generative adversarial nets; Mode collapse problem;
D O I
10.1007/978-3-030-67661-2_15
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Implicit generative models are difficult to train as no explicit density functions are defined. Generative adversarial nets (GANs) present a minimax framework to train such models, which however can suffer from mode collapse due to the nature of the JS-divergence. This paper presents a learning by teaching (LBT) approach to learning implicit models, which intrinsically avoids the mode collapse problem by optimizing a KL-divergence rather than the JS-divergence in GANs. In LBT, an auxiliary density estimator is introduced to fit the implicit model's distribution while the implicit model teaches the density estimator to match the data distribution. LBT is formulated as a bilevel optimization problem, whose optimal generator matches the true data distribution. LBT can be naturally integrated with GANs to derive a hybrid LBT-GAN that enjoys complimentary benefits. Finally, we present a stochastic gradient ascent algorithm with unrolling to solve the challenging learning problems. Experimental results demonstrate the effectiveness of our method.
引用
收藏
页码:239 / 255
页数:17
相关论文
共 50 条
  • [21] Generative chemistry: drug discovery with deep learning generative models
    Yuemin Bian
    Xiang-Qun Xie
    Journal of Molecular Modeling, 2021, 27
  • [22] Learning Generative Models with Sinkhorn Divergences
    Genevay, Aude
    Peyre, Gabriel
    Cuturi, Marco
    INTERNATIONAL CONFERENCE ON ARTIFICIAL INTELLIGENCE AND STATISTICS, VOL 84, 2018, 84
  • [23] Learning generative models of molecular dynamics
    Narges Sharif Razavian
    Hetunandan Kamisetty
    Christopher J Langmead
    BMC Genomics, 13
  • [24] Continual learning with invertible generative models
    Pomponi, Jary
    Scardapane, Simone
    Uncini, Aurelio
    NEURAL NETWORKS, 2023, 164 : 606 - 616
  • [25] Learning Generative Models with Visual Attention
    Tang, Yichuan
    Srivastava, Nitish
    Salakhutdinov, Ruslan
    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 27 (NIPS 2014), 2014, 27
  • [26] Learning generative models of molecular dynamics
    Razavian, Narges Sharif
    Kamisetty, Hetunandan
    Langmead, Christopher J.
    BMC GENOMICS, 2012, 13
  • [27] Learning Generative Models of Shape Handles
    Gadelha, Matheus
    Gori, Giorgio
    Ceylan, Duygu
    Mech, Radomir
    Carr, Nathan
    Boubekeur, Tamy
    Wang, Rui
    Maji, Subhransu
    2020 IEEE/CVF C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R), 2020, : 399 - 408
  • [28] Learning Generative Models of Scene Features
    Robert Sim
    Gregory Dudek
    International Journal of Computer Vision, 2004, 60 : 45 - 61
  • [29] Learning generative models of scene features
    Sim, R
    Dudek, G
    INTERNATIONAL JOURNAL OF COMPUTER VISION, 2004, 60 (01) : 45 - 61
  • [30] Learning generative models of scene features
    Sim, R
    Dudek, G
    2001 IEEE COMPUTER SOCIETY C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ION, VOL 1, PROCEEDINGS, 2001, : 406 - 412